M. Marie Ryals was born in the old mill town of Ceylon, near Satilla Bluff in Camden County, Georgia and lived most of her 99 years on St Simons Island,GA. Her grandchildren all called her MeMa, she was loving, witty and sharp as a tack right up to the end. She loved the Atlanta Braves, never missed an episode of Young and the Restless and we will all remember her big poster of Tom Selleck on the refrigerator door. She made the best sweet tea that no one has been able to duplicate.

Her mother was Priscilla Faulkner (Lizzy P Ribron in Palmetto Cemetery records)
Her father was Christopher Columbus Ryals
She was married to Euston Clements Chitty and they had 5 children:
Wade E Chitty
Maurice C Chitty (Reese)
Katherine C Chitty Wiggins
Christie Ann Chitty Manry
William Allen Chitty
She had 10 grandchildren at the time of her passing.

She was so proud to be 99 years old and she would tell everybody she met while siting on the St Simons pier or "picnicking under the tables" at the two large live oaks in front of the casino. She so wanted to make it to 100. Though her mind was sharp her poor bones could no longer hold her tall frame (she was 5'10") and she passed peacefully at The Hospice of the Golden Isles in Brunswick with her loving family by her side. It was the only time she ever left the island in countless years, she wouldn't even leave for approaching hurricanes. Godspeed MeMa.
